Monolith Festival returned after a 2 year break with an all overseas and very prog heavy lineup at Hordern Pavilion

The Sydney show opened with French metalcore act Novelists who recently added a female vocalist Camille Contreras making their Australian debut.

Intervals masterfully blended djent and prog while Leprous returned for the first time since 2019 Progfest and were warmly welcomed for their iconic riffs and vocals.

Periphery were one of the biggest sets of the night with a mix of new and old tracks welcomed by a fanatic audience.

A series of workshops were run during the day with drums, guitar and other available. The night was closed with the legendary Coheed & Cambria with a social NEVERENDER set.
